Invisible privilege: constitutes an invisible package of unearned assets or advantages mcintosh 2007. On the basis of privileged identities can poison workplaces. Harassment defined in subsection 10(1) of the ontario human rights code as. Engaging in the course of vexatious comment or conduct that is known or ought to be reasonable known to be unwelcome. Wingfield points to the way in the glass escalator is informed by both racial and gender privilege. Examined experiences of black men in the nursing profession and found their treatment and limited opportunities illustrated that the glass escalator effect was not the same for all men. Wingfield argues research operates from a racial homogenous lens, meaning all men can advice in female-dominate professions which is not true.
